Pepper Money hires former CBA executive Adam Croucher

Pepper Money has appointed Adam Croucher, the former general manager of third party banking at Commonwealth Bank, as its state manager for Victoria.

The experienced and respected industry leader left CommBank in June 2023 after spending 18 years there working in various roles.

Non-bank lender Pepper Money on Wednesday announced its appointment of Croucher (pictured above) as its state manager for Victoria, with the role to officially start on Monday, April 15.

Pepper Money said Croucher brought a wealth of experience to Pepper Money, notching up 24 years in the banking sector.

“His tenure at Commonwealth Bank of Australia equipped him with valuable insights having held various management roles, including managing retail branches and leading third-party banking teams,” it said.

Croucher, who was succeeded in his CBA general manager of third party banking role by Razia Khan, said he was excited about his role at Pepper Money.
